Copsleigh Way - RH1 5BE
Key Street Insights
Copsleigh Way is a residential street with 10 addresses.
It ranks as the 127th largest and 368th most expensive of the 582 streets in the RH1 area. The most common property type is a mid-century house built between 1936 and 1979.
The street contains a total of 10 properties: 10 houses.

Sales Market Trends
The last sale on Copsleigh Way sold for £640,000 on 27th February 2026. Since then prices are up an average of 0.3%.
The current average value in the street is £540,840.
The Copsleigh Way Sales Market has increased by 19.0% over the last 10 years.
